摘要

The diagnosis of radio frequency (RF) channels (chains) is crucial in the mass production stage of wireless devices. However, the conventional conducted testing for the RF channel diagnosis is inconvenient for devices with integrated antennas. This work presents a cost-effective and time-efficient over-the-air (OTA) diagnostic approach for performance evaluations of the RF channels in a nondisruptive manner, applicable for wireless devices in time division duplex (TDD) mode. A new unidirectional search method is put forward to reduce the measurement uncertainty. The maximum absolute deviation between the proposed method and conducted testing was only 0.3 dB. Small measurement uncertainties of the whole testing system for the RF output power test and sensitivity test confirm the effectiveness of the proposed methodology.
